diff options
author | Harald Musum <musum@yahooinc.com> | 2023-12-19 22:50:45 +0100 |
---|---|---|
committer | Harald Musum <musum@yahooinc.com> | 2023-12-19 22:50:45 +0100 |
commit | 8146bbf2e2b022902bfed1c93d1d084471cb22a9 (patch) | |
tree | a3ad74bc54aa559809145babc70e000c97f6a695 /config-model | |
parent | 2e8de87bcd8f7b6b9c39b25877b0a6600580cf7d (diff) |
Store onnx model info after deciding if we need to restart on deploy
Need to store (in ZK) so that info is available on all config servers
Diffstat (limited to 'config-model')
-rw-r--r-- | config-model/src/main/java/com/yahoo/vespa/model/application/validation/change/RestartOnDeployForOnnxModelChangesValidator.java |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/config-model/src/main/java/com/yahoo/vespa/model/application/validation/change/RestartOnDeployForOnnxModelChangesValidator.java b/config-model/src/main/java/com/yahoo/vespa/model/application/validation/change/RestartOnDeployForOnnxModelChangesValidator.java index 8da7f34048b..398538d187f 100644 --- a/config-model/src/main/java/com/yahoo/vespa/model/application/validation/change/RestartOnDeployForOnnxModelChangesValidator.java +++ b/config-model/src/main/java/com/yahoo/vespa/model/application/validation/change/RestartOnDeployForOnnxModelChangesValidator.java @@ -99,6 +99,7 @@ public class RestartOnDeployForOnnxModelChangesValidator implements ChangeValida private static void setRestartOnDeployAndAddRestartAction(List<ConfigChangeAction> actions, ApplicationContainerCluster cluster, String message) { log.log(INFO, message); cluster.onnxModelCostCalculator().setRestartOnDeploy(); + cluster.onnxModelCostCalculator().store(); actions.add(new VespaRestartAction(cluster.id(), message)); } |